Santiaga Hernandez 1914 - 1998

Santiaga Hernandez of San Antonio, Bexar County, TX was born on January 30, 1914, and died at age 84 years old on June 17, 1998.

In 1914, in the year that Santiaga Hernandez was born, in August, the world's first red and green traffic lights were installed at the corner of East 105th Street and Euclid Avenue in Cleveland Ohio. The electric traffic light had been invented by a policeman in Salt Lake City Utah in 1912.

In 1946, this person was 32 years old when pediatrician Dr. Benjamin Spock's book "The Common Sense Book of Baby and Child Care" was published. It sold half a million copies in the first six months. Aside from the Bible, it became the best selling book of the 20th century. A generation of Baby Boomers were raised by the advice of Dr. Spock.
